Any ideas to clean the fabric and pipes that corroded on my Eskimo quick flip.

When it gets warm out. (notice i did not say nice out) Set it up in the yard get some mild detergent and scrub it good rinse well. As for the Poles you will have to sand them down or use steel wool. Then coat them. I like dry graphite but a good silicone spray will work to. Check them again in the fall. Coat em again.
